Safety Information

Handle with standard laboratory precautions. Contains borate compounds that may cause mild eye and skin irritation. Use appropriate protective equipment including safety goggles and gloves. Avoid ingestion and ensure adequate ventilation. Rinse thoroughly if contact occurs.

Storage & Handling

Store in original sealed containers at room temperature away from CO₂ sources and acidic vapors. Minimize air exposure to prevent carbonate formation and pH drift. Use clean equipment to avoid contamination. Replace cap immediately after use to maintain alkaline pH accuracy.
